Rivers Casino Portsmouth is readying to defend its Hampton Roads stronghold on casino gambling A temporary casino will open in nearby Norfolk in September Rivers Portsmouth is amid construction of its first on-site hotel Rivers Casino Portsmouth will soon lose its monopoly on casino gambling in Virginia’s Hampton Roads when The Interim Gaming Hall in Norfolk opens this fall. A rendering of The Landing, the forthcoming hotel at Rivers Casino Portsmouth. Rivers Portsmouth is prepping for nearby competition when a temporary casino opens in Norfolk in September 2025. (Image: Rivers Casino Portsmouth) In preparation for the nearby competition, Rivers Portsmouth, owned and operated by Chicago-based Rush Street Gaming, announced in May the construction of a 106-key hotel with 32 suites. Described as an “upscale” lodging facility, the property, called The Landing Hotel, will offer casino gamblers on-site accommodations.
